解密云弹性架构:动态资源调配新策略
|
在数字化浪潮席卷全球的今天,企业对IT基础设施的需求正以前所未有的速度增长。传统静态资源部署方式已难以应对业务波动带来的挑战,尤其是在流量高峰或突发性访问激增时,系统往往因资源不足而崩溃,或在低谷期造成大量资源闲置。为解决这一难题,云弹性架构应运而生,成为现代应用稳定运行的核心支撑。 云弹性架构的本质,是让计算资源能够根据实际负载自动伸缩。当应用负载上升,系统可迅速调用更多虚拟机、容器或函数实例来分担压力;当负载下降,则自动释放多余资源,避免浪费。这种动态调配能力,使得企业既能保障服务的高可用性,又能有效控制成本,真正实现“按需使用、按量付费”。 实现弹性调度的关键在于智能监控与自动化决策。云平台通过实时采集CPU使用率、内存占用、网络吞吐、请求延迟等指标,构建出系统的运行状态画像。一旦检测到性能瓶颈或资源紧张,系统便触发弹性策略,如自动扩展实例数量、调整资源配置比例,甚至启动新的服务节点。这些操作无需人工干预,全程由算法驱动,响应速度可达秒级。 弹性架构还融合了多层级的资源管理机制。例如,在微服务架构中,不同服务模块可根据自身特性独立伸缩。一个用户登录服务可能在早高峰需求激增,而后台数据处理服务则在夜间批量任务期间才需要高算力。通过精细化的资源配置策略,系统可以做到精准匹配,避免“一刀切”的资源浪费。
AI生成3D模型,仅供参考 为了提升弹性响应的可靠性,现代云平台普遍采用预测性扩容机制。基于历史数据和机器学习模型,系统能预判未来一段时间内的流量趋势,提前部署资源,避免在高峰期出现“来不及扩容”的尴尬。这种前瞻性调度不仅提升了用户体验,也降低了突发故障的风险。 值得注意的是,弹性并非无限制扩张。合理的资源上限设定、冷却时间控制以及降级策略,都是确保系统稳定运行的重要环节。例如,在极端情况下,即使资源耗尽,系统仍可通过限流、缓存降级或返回简化页面等方式维持基本功能,避免雪崩式崩溃。 随着边缘计算与Serverless技术的发展,弹性架构正向更轻量化、更敏捷的方向演进。开发者不再关心底层服务器,只需专注于代码逻辑,平台自动完成资源分配与生命周期管理。这极大降低了运维门槛,加速了应用交付周期。 总而言之,解密云弹性架构,核心在于“感知—决策—执行”的闭环机制。它不仅是技术进步的体现,更是企业数字化转型中实现敏捷、高效与可持续发展的关键路径。在瞬息万变的数字世界里,弹性,正成为无形却至关重要的竞争力。 (编辑:开发网_新乡站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330465号